Visual Studio 2005 Pro は UML スタイルのクラス図を生成できますか?
3 に答える
ソリューション エクスプローラー ウィンドウの拡大鏡アイコンをクリックできます。次に、ダイアグラムが生成されます。
2005 には UML モデラーがありません。上記のクラス デザイナーを使用すると、クラスのモデル化とコード生成を行うことができますが、それ自体は UML ツールではありません。モデルからのコード生成に関心がない場合は、Viso を使用することをお勧めします。真の UML モデルからコードを生成したい場合は、 Enterprise Architectのようなものを検討することをお勧めします。
ただし、 2010 Team Systemには完全な UML モデリングとコード生成が組み込まれているはずです。待つのはあと 1 年だけです :-P
そのページの詳細:
Visual Studio 2005 クラス デザイナー
ビジュアル スタジオ .NET 2003
- 適用対象: Visual Studio® 2005
概要:
Visual Studio クラス デザイナーを使用すると、クラスの構造とそれらの関係を視覚化し、ビジュアル デザイン環境を使用して新しいクラスを作成し、クラスを簡単にリファクタリングできます。このホワイトペーパーでは、これらのタスクのいくつかについて説明します。(印刷された7ページ)はじめ
に Visual Studio クラス デザイナーは、共通言語ランタイム用の完全に機能するビジュアル デザイン環境です。Visual Studio クラス デザイナーを使用すると、クラスやその他の型の構造を視覚化し、これらの視覚的表現を通じてソース コードを編集できます。クラス ダイアグラムに加えられた変更はすぐにコードに反映され、コードに加えられた変更はすぐにデザイナーの外観に反映されます。デザイナーとコードの間のこの同期関係により、複雑な CLR 型を視覚的に簡単に作成および構成できます。クラス デザイナーには、コードのリファクタリングに役立つように特別に設計された機能が含まれており、識別子の名前を簡単に変更したり、メソッドをオーバーライドしたりできます。クラスと構造体を自動的に生成し、スタブを自動的に生成することでインターフェイスを実装できます。
最後に、クラス デザイナーは、コード ベースの領域を同僚に簡単に伝達できるようにすることで、コミュニケーション ツールとしても機能します。クラス ダイアグラムは、ハード コピーに印刷したり、HTML ページや PowerPoint プレゼンテーションで表示するために画像として保存したりできます。
注:
このドキュメントは、製品が製造にリリースされる前に作成されたものであるため、ここに記載されている詳細と出荷された製品に記載されている内容との不一致が見つかる場合があります。この情報は、このドキュメントが作成された時点の製品に基づいており、計画目的でのみ使用してください。情報は予告なく変更される場合があります。...